關于舉辦iPhone與iPAD高端應用開發
培訓通知
培訓時間:2013年5月25日至5月27日(5月24日報到)北京
2013年12月27日至12月29日(12月26日報到)上海
各有關單位:
為響應工業和信息化部 “工業和信息化領域緊缺人才培養工程”,我中心針對目前企事業單位信息技術研發人員對iPhone/iPad技術的緊迫需求,設計推出了iPhone實戰課程。主要講授Apple iPhone/iPad手機開發平臺的應用開發、手機圖形系統、移動互聯網等開發。旨在提高學員在Apple iTouch、iPhone4、iPhone5、iPad等系列上開發高端應用程序的能力。全面詳細講解在iPhone平臺程序開發細節,完整講述iPhone應用程序開發、構建、發布整個過程。具體事宜如下:
一、課程目標
本課程使用最新的iPhone SDK 5.x版本,也就是IOS5系列SDK開發程序。當然開發程序可以用于iPhone, iPhone3, iPhone4, iPhone5, iPad, iPad2等硬件上。通過4天的強化,可以讓學員在iPhone系列手機上開發基本的UI應用程序,網絡服務程序,多媒體服務和一些2D方面的動畫等目標。達到可以在iPhone上開發基本的應用程序的能力。
二、學習對象
廣大從事IOS工作的IT技術人員及愛好者,包括研發工程師、解決方案工程師、系統維護工程師等。
三、授課師資
王老師 事過7年的移動應用開發、系統架構經驗。對SOA\分布式應用及架構設計有著獨特的認知;6年的IOS開發經驗,對于IOS4.1、5.0、5.1版本進行過項目開發。
五、培訓證書
本課程頒發雙證,證書查詢:www.ncie.gov.cn;www.zpedu.org
1、工業和信息化部人才交流中心頒發的《全國信息化工程師》證書。
2、中國信息化培訓中心頒發的《IOS高級架構師》證書。
證書可作為專業技術人員職業能力考核的證明,以及專業技術人員崗位聘用、任職、定級和晉升職務的重要依據。
六、培訓費用
4500 元/人(含培訓費、考試費、證書費、資料費、午餐) 食宿統一安排,費用自理。(請學員帶二寸彩照2張—背面注明姓名,身份證復印件一張)。
六、具體課程安排
日程 模塊單元 模塊單元
第一天 第一單元iPhoneSDK
本階段開始開始熟悉iPhone應用程序開發的工具:iPhoneSDK(xcode)。本階段會講解iPhoneSDK的基本用法,以及一些常用的快捷方式如:.h.m文件之間的快捷切換、appleAPI的快速定位查看,幫助文檔的定位查看和創建工程需要注意的具體事宜。 第二單元Objective-C語言強化
本階段開始學習iOS的特有的編程語言Objective-C,該種語言屬于C/C++的一個變種,可以和C/C++混合使用。本階段講解Objective-C語言的面向對象編程,類的繼承,復合,多態,id,動態識別,Posing,Protocols,內存管理,Autorelease等主要內容。
第二天 第三單元Foundation Kit編程強化
主要學習iOS中核心類的編程使用。為后面UI,網絡,多媒體等編程打好良好的基礎。主要內容包括:字符串類(NSString, NSMutableString),集合類 (NSArray, NSMutableArray, NSDictionary, NSMutableDictionary, NSSet ),NSEnumerator , NSNumber, NSValue, NSNull,NSData等各類蘋果iOS特性的類和方法。 第四單元Interface Builder控件使用(項目實例)使用Interface Builder創建UI項目工程,理解File Owner,First Responder,理解協議的概念。詳細分析IBOutlet和IBAction的作用和使用。理解各類控件在IB上的屬性配置和事件處理。包括事件響應鏈,UIResponder類介紹。事件傳遞機制。UIEvent類, UITouch類,UIControl類,XCode中動態加入事件處理,在Interface Builder中圖形化加入事件處理,鍵盤事件的處理以及事件的機制,從指定XIB文件中加載視圖,調試器的使用。
第三天 第五單元創建視圖控制器(項目實例)
iOS中MVC模型介紹,UIViewController基類介紹。UIViewController和UIView關系。UITableView、UITableViewCell、UITableViewController使用,自定義UITableViewCell,復合控件UITabBarController創建多個Tab標簽的空間,UINavigationController導航控件。翻轉控制器,了解應用程序的運行生命周期以及后臺任務處理模式。 第六單元網絡編程定位(項目實例)
iOS網絡編程,CFNetwork各種常用類介紹。NSURL,NSURLRequest,UIWebView, NSMutableURLRequest等類使用。
使用UIWebVie